angularJs 表格添加刪除修改查詢方法
更新時間:2018年02月27日 14:41:39 作者:余生I
下面小編就為大家分享一篇angularJs 表格添加刪除修改查詢方法,具有很好的參考價值,希望對大家有所幫助。一起跟隨小編過來看看吧
如下所示: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Title</title>
<script src="agl/angular.min.js"></script>
<script>
var app=angular.module("mpp",[]);
app.controller("ctrl",function ($scope) {
$scope.arr=[];
$scope.add=function () {
$scope.arr.push({name:$scope.name,password:$scope.password,age:$scope.age,sex:$scope.sex})
}
$scope.submit=function () {
for (var i=0;i<$scope.arr.length;i++)
{
if($scope.arr[i].name==$scope.name2)
{
if($scope.arr[i].password==$scope.pass)
{
if($scope.pass2==$scope.pass){
$scope.arr[i].password=$scope.pass2;
}else{
alert("兩次輸入不一致");
}
}else {
alert("密碼錯誤");
}
}else {
alert("用戶名錯誤");
}
}
}
$scope.flag=false;
$scope.show=function () {
$scope.flag=true;
}
})
</script>
<link rel="stylesheet" href="css/style.css" rel="external nofollow" >
</head>
<body ng-app="mpp" ng-controller="ctrl">
<div class="inner">
<input type="text" placeholder="用戶名查詢" ng-model="user">
<input type="text" placeholder="年齡范圍查詢" ng-model="ages">
<select ng-model="sexs">
<option value="男">男</option>
<option value="女">女</option></select>
<button>全部刪除</button>
<TABLE>
<tr>
<th>Id</th>
<th>用戶名</th>
<th>密碼</th>
<th>年齡</th>
<th>性別</th>
<th>操作</th>
</tr>
<tr ng-repeat="item in arr|filter:{name:user}|filter:{age:ages}|filter:{sex:sexs}">
<td>{{$index+1}}</td>
<td>{{item.name}}</td>
<td>{{item.password}}</td>
<td>{{item.age}}</td>
<td>{{item.sex}}</td>
<td><button ng-click="show()">修改密碼</button></td>
</tr>
</TABLE>
<button ng-click="add()">添加用戶</button>
<div class="conner">
<div class="add">
用戶名:<input type="text" ng-model="name"><br>
密 碼:<input type="password" ng-model="password"><br>
年 齡:<input type="text" ng-model="age"><br>
性 別:<select ng-model="sex">
<option value="男">男</option>
<option value="女">女</option></select><br>
</div>
<div class="update" ng-show="flag">
用戶名:<input type="text" ng-model="name2"><br>
舊密碼:<input type="text" ng-model="pass"><br>
新密碼:<input type="password" ng-model="pass2"><br>
確認密碼:<input type="password" ng-model="pass3"><br>
</div>
</div>
<button ng-click="submit()">提交</button>
</div>
</body>
</html>
css
*{
margin: 0;
padding: 0;
}
.inner{
margin: 20px auto;
text-align: center;
}
table{
margin: 10px auto;
text-align: center;
}
tr{
border-collapse: collapse;
}
tr th,td{
border:1px solid #000000;
width: 60px;
}
.conner{
width: 600px;
height: 300px;
background: #ffe7e0;
margin: 0 auto;
}
.add{
margin: 10px auto;
padding-top: 20px;
width: 260px;
height: 120px;
border: 2px solid #e42112;
}
.update{
width: 280px;
height: 120px;
border: 2px solid #e42112;
text-align: center;
margin: 10px auto;
padding-top: 20px;
}
以上這篇angularJs 表格添加刪除修改查詢方法就是小編分享給大家的全部內容了,希望能給大家一個參考,也希望大家多多支持腳本之家。
您可能感興趣的文章:
相關文章
Angular 中使用 FineReport不顯示報表直接打印預覽
這篇文章主要介紹了Angular 中使用 FineReport不顯示報表直接打印預覽,非常不錯,具有一定的參考借鑒價值,需要的朋友可以參考下2019-08-08
使用Angular 6創(chuàng)建各種動畫效果的方法
Angular能夠讓我們創(chuàng)建出具有原生表現(xiàn)效果的動畫。我們將通過本文學習到如何使用Angular 6來創(chuàng)建各種動畫效果。在此,我們將使用Visual Studio Code來進行示例演示。感興趣的朋友跟隨小編一起看看吧2018-10-10
Angular利用內容投射向組件輸入ngForOf模板的方法
本篇文章主要介紹了Angular利用內容投射向組件輸入ngForOf模板的方法,小編覺得挺不錯的,現(xiàn)在分享給大家,也給大家做個參考。一起跟隨小編過來看看吧2018-03-03
Angular.js項目中使用gulp實現(xiàn)自動化構建以及壓縮打包詳解
基于流的前端自動化構建工具,利用gulp可以提高前端開發(fā)效率,特別是在前后端分離的項目中。下面這篇文章主要給大家介紹了關于在Angular.js項目中使用gulp實現(xiàn)自動化構建以及壓縮打包的相關資料,需要的朋友可以參考下。2017-07-07
Angularjs的ng-repeat中去除重復數(shù)據(jù)的方法
這篇文章主要介紹了Angularjs的ng-repeat中去除重復數(shù)據(jù)的方法,涉及AngularJS針對重復數(shù)據(jù)的遍歷與過濾技巧,需要的朋友可以參考下2016-08-08

